The Superior National Forest is soliciting proposals from interested parties for a concession special use permit to operate and maintain a variety of Government-owned recreation facilities. The prospectus offers 10 campgrounds. The new special use permit will be issued to the selected applicant. The existing special use permit for the current concessionaire expires December 31, 2023.
Guided tours will be facilitated by the Forest Service on August 8, 2023 (Tofte Ranger District) and August 9, 2023 (Gunflint Ranger District). Applicants are also strongly encouraged to visit the sites before submitting an application. Interested parties must RSVP by August 1, 2023 to ryan.blaisdell@usda.gov.
All prospective applicants are advised to read the prospectus carefully. All applicants must submit their application as specified under section IV. Application of the prospectus. Applications must be received by close of business on September 15, 2023.
The Forest will complete the application evaluation and make their decision by the end of 2023, with the intention of the successful applicant beginning operations in the 2024 season.
